New Cloud Security Alliance Paper Explores How Enterprises Can Augment, Integrate DNS Systems With Software-Defined Perimeter (SDP) to Enhance Security
Setting and enforcing policy at the DNS layer isnt compute-intensive and has the further advantage of being able to scale to millions.
- Setting and enforcing policy at the DNS layer isnt compute-intensive and has the further advantage of being able to scale to millions.
- DDI services can provide enterprises with visibility and control, and when combined with SDP can deliver considerably improved security and help organizations advance their Zero Trust security journeys.
- Integrating the three core systems that comprise DDI helps provide control, automation, and security for todays modern and highly distributed networks.
